How it works

Estimate ecommerce ROI in four steps

The calculator compounds the measured conversion and order-value uplifts, then subtracts the plan cost you enter. Use the monthly and yearly views to compare the estimate with your current sales.

  1. 1

    Enter monthly online sales

    Add the revenue your ecommerce store generates in a typical month.

  2. 2

    Enter the monthly plan cost

    Use the default Serviceform plan cost or replace it with the monthly cost you want to assess.

  3. 3

    Review the estimated uplift

    The calculator applies an 8% conversion uplift, then a 16% average order value uplift to the conversion-adjusted sales.

  4. 4

    Compare revenue with cost

    Review the added revenue and net return monthly or yearly. Net return is estimated added revenue minus the plan cost.

Frequently asked questions

Ecommerce ROI calculator FAQ

What does this ecommerce ROI calculator estimate?

It estimates added revenue from an 8% conversion uplift and a 16% increase in average order value, then subtracts the monthly Serviceform plan cost to show estimated net return.

What are the calculator assumptions based on?

The 8% conversion uplift and 16% average order value uplift are based on A/B tests across 13 stores from January to March 2026.

Why is the combined revenue uplift more than 24%?

The uplifts compound. The 16% average order value increase is applied after the 8% conversion uplift, producing a combined estimated revenue uplift of about 25.3%.

How is net return calculated?

Net return is the estimated added revenue from the two compounded uplifts minus the Serviceform plan cost entered in the calculator.

Are the results guaranteed?

No. The results are estimates based on the sales and cost you enter and the stated A/B test assumptions. Actual results depend on factors such as traffic, catalogue and follow-up.
